Analysis of claims-moonbirb.com indicates that the domain was registered on 21 February 2026 through NiceNIC International Group Co., Limited. The authoritative name servers are lara.ns.cloudflare.com and otto.ns.cloudflare.com, both belonging to Cloudflare's DNS service. DNS resolution points to IP address 104.21.30.91, which is owned by Cloudflare, Inc. (AS13335) and geolocated to the United States. No TLS certificate is presented for the site, suggesting that HTTPS is not configured. The HTTP response returns a page titled “Just a moment…”, and the domain is currently marked as offline.
VirusTotal has recorded six positive detections out of ninety‑three scanning engines, confirming that multiple security vendors consider the domain malicious. Independent blocklist monitoring shows the domain listed on three public blocklists and specifically blocked by PhishDestroy, MetaMask, and SEAL, reinforcing its classification as a crypto‑related scam. The threat taxonomy supplied labels it as a “Crypto Scam” with a more precise sub‑type of “crypto drainer”, and the risk level is elevated. The available evidence points to a typical infrastructure pattern used by crypto‑draining operations: rapid provisioning on a reputable CDN (Cloudflare), short‑lived domain registration, and absence of TLS to avoid certificate costs. However, the precise payload or transaction‑draining mechanism has not been observed; the page content beyond the title remains un‑analysed, and no malware hashes or command‑and‑control endpoints have been disclosed.
Consequently, the full scope of the threat—such as targeted wallets or phishing forms—remains uncertain. Defenders should immediately add claims-moonbirb.com to DNS‑ and web‑filter block lists, enforce outbound traffic inspection for connections to the associated Cloudflare IP range, and monitor for newly created domains that resolve to the same name servers or IP address.
